Holy Mass: The Priest, the Boxer and the Roadrunners

2011 75 min

Maurie Crocker was a tough man, tattooed and near-toothless. He was a Special Forces soldier, a priest, trainer of a world-class prize fighter, and champion of street kids abused by pedophiles. He fought for and won justice against a mayor, other priests, teachers and the church hierarchy, but then he fought his own personal fight alone.
